In your role as Account Director, you will be expected to

  • Act as the primary point of contact for key clients in Canada and the United States, overseeing both large-scale web design and development projects and ongoing evolution and support mandates with public and private sector clients
  • Develop and grow client accounts by identifying and cultivating key relationships and growth opportunities in line with the agency’s services
  • Ensure timely and successful project delivery in alignment with customer needs and objectives
  • Develop and approve briefs for projects, providing guidance and direction to project teams
  • Lead and participate in client presentations and other activities to enhance agency-client relationships
  • Lead contract negotiations with new clients and manage contract renewals
  • Provide clear and concise updates to clients and agency leadership
  • Forecast and track key account metrics, reporting on account status and opportunities

Requirements

To be successful, you should have the following skills and experience

  • Minimum of 5 years experience in an agency setting or professional services
  • Exceptional listening skills with the ability to understand and address client needs
  • Proven track record in the management and delivery of successful client portfolio projects
  • Proficient in digital best practices, technologies, and trends - a plus if you have experience using Drupal, WordPress, or other open-source technologies
  • Experience managing client relationships and acting as an escalation point
  • Comfortable with public speaking and presentations
  • Track record of setting and achieving goals in a fast-paced environment
  • Experience in team supervision or management
  • Excellent communication skills in English

Remote applications based in North America are welcome but the applicant must be

  • Available during Montreal working hours
  • Use tools such as Slack to stay engaged with your team and contribute to the company culture
  • Have exceptional self-management and proactive communication skills

What We Do

Evolving Web is a full-service digital agency. We empower organizations to adapt to the ever-changing digital landscape and create digital platforms that are designed for growth. We give you the tools and training to own and grow your digital platform so you can set your story in motion. Our diverse team of 100+ includes developers, project managers, QA specialists, designers, marketers, and experts in content and digital strategy. We are headquartered in Montreal. Our staff hail from 29 countries and are fluent in over 25 languages. Our projects are data-driven and user-centric. We’re known for our technical expertise and ability to deliver complex, large-scale projects for world-renowned organizations. We run a professional training program, organize the EvolveDrupal digital summits, and contribute significantly to open source.
